Job description

Who we are looking for

Who we are looking for The major focus of this role is the supervision and review of Investor Services processes in accordance with internal controls and procedures. Your new role As Investor Services Team Supervisor, Senior Associate you will Supervise daily Investor Services processes (investor set up, transactions processing, reporting, communication with 3rd parties, payments processing, etc.) Demonstrate timely, accurate process of the relevant tasks at all times in accordance with SLAs, operating procedures and legal regulations Perform independently all tasks described in the relevant procedures and job aids Ensure a timely update of procedures and Job aids Support and lead day to day run of the operations executed by the team Support the Manager in assurance all activities are sufficiently covered at all times, included during sickness and holidays periods Ensure that the other team members are properly trained Make recommendations for changes to processes and procedures and prepare documentation for review as required Take responsibility for personal development and training Set and maintain standards of personal and professional performance/behavior; ensure staff accountability and adherence to company policies and procedures Coordinate and implement technical training and development activities for individuals and the team Monitor the performance of team – provide formal and informal feedbacks to the team members and the team manager Hold ad hoc 1 to1 with the team members to discuss operational matters if necessary Support and participate in company committees and initiatives Take responsibility for the quality of service to assigned client Plan and manage the daily processes and the effective utilization of resources Monitor errors and potential breaches; complete relevant documentation and ensure training needs are identified and relevant trainings are carried out. Keep record of all errors and monitor the resolution status Ensure adherence to Company and Departmental policies and procedures Develop and maintain good relationships with internal and external clients, colleagues in service support departments and contacts in Donor Sites Act as a main point of contact for the team
